History
We are a rural credit union located just outside the Winnipeg city limits. The credit union was incorporated in 1940 with 15 Members and one hundred and twenty five dollars in deposits. In the last 71 years, the credit union has grown to $140,000,000 in assets representing over 4,100 Members. We believe in the local control of our Member-owned business.
As such, our seven person Board of Directors are all farmers and business people within our trade area. We opened a branch in Headingley, Manitoba in 1994. When you deposit your money with our institution, about 80% of the money is immediately reinvested back into our trade area in the form of loans and lines of credit.
